使用turtle来画奥运五环使用turtle进行图形化的程序设计来绘制自己想要的图形

本文介绍了如何利用Python的turtle库进行图形化编程,具体展示了如何画出奥运五环。首先导入turtle模块并命名,然后通过控制箭头移动、画圆、改变颜色等操作,依次绘制不同大小和颜色的圆,每次画圆前后需抬起和放下画笔。此过程涉及坐标计算、颜色设置及线条粗细调整。

使用turtle进行图形化的程序设计。

  • showturtle()显示箭头

  • write()书写一段字符串在屏幕上

  • forward(px)向前运动,px是运动像素距离

  • backward(px)向后运动,px是运动像素距离

  • clear()方法会清空屏幕,reset()会重置整个绘图程序,一切数据恢复初始值

  • pendown/penup 方下/抬起画笔

  • right/left向左/右转,参数填写要旋转的角度

  • color()用来设置画笔的颜色,使用颜色的英文单词字符串设置画笔颜色

  • goto用来设置小乌龟出现的坐标位置

  • cirle()画一个圆,参数是半径

  • pensize()调整笔画粗细

例如:使用turtle来画奥运五环

一,首先打开idle,导入turtle(import turtle)并命名(as)为(t),展现出来(showtutle)

二,先画第一个圆定点(注意起点是箭头所处位)

三,画第二个圆

以此类推,通过计算横纵坐标来判断箭头落点.

要注意的是每一次都要up将笔抬起,down将笔放下.

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值